**Mgmt Meeting Minutes — Retiring the Brightline Range**

Quick recap for sales leads at Fenholt Supplies: we agreed to retire the Brightline fixture range by year-end. Remaining stock moves to clearance pricing next month, and accounts on standing orders get migrated to the Lumetta range. Trade-in incentives were approved in principle. The confidential note on next steps sits just below.

board note of bajof-bajeg: The pricing group signed off on a budget of $13.4 million for Project Sildor. The renewal with Lamixek Holdings closes at $48.9 million a year, 49 percent above the last contract.

**Vendor note: Inkmill markdown pipeline**

Rendering for Parchway docs is outsourced to Inkmill under an annual contract, renewing each March. They handle sanitization and PDF export; we own the upload queue. SLA: 4-hour response on rendering failures. Escalate only after two failed retries. Their support desk is reachable at the address below.

billing contact of hahaf-baguf = zorael.tammir.jorius@sivrelhq.internal

**Ticket PK-884: Config drift in Ladlewise scaling service**

The recipe-scaling calculator on the Ladlewise staging cluster has drifted from production: rounding precision and unit-conversion tables differ, producing mismatched yields for batch recipes. Please audit carefully before restarting workers, since cached conversions persist across deploys. The production instance is currently serving with the configuration shown below.

settings of tagef-bawif:
DRUIX_HOST=druix.zemvarlabs.internal
DRUIX_PORT=8000